Output c74256f9694bef3feeca81b456b291ef1d7dfdcfdc4e052ddafa991998367b6a:15

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d89d6e1cfbf64421eae3c0fd2c4113e6ac7ef10 OP_EQUAL
address
34PCeMYj31HjMhNjD4WiJgLbiYHbdDwpbR
transaction
c74256f9694bef3feeca81b456b291ef1d7dfdcfdc4e052ddafa991998367b6a
confirmations
340630
spent
true